What Is GEO and Why Does It Matter for Dayton Law Firms?

Generative Engine Optimization — GEO — is the practice of structuring your firm’s digital presence so that AI-powered platforms like ChatGPT, Google’s AI Overviews, Bing Copilot, and Perplexity AI cite your content when users ask legal questions. Traditional SEO gets you ranked. GEO gets you quoted.

When someone in Dayton asks an AI assistant, “Who is the best personal injury lawyer near downtown Dayton?” or “Which family law attorneys handle cases in Montgomery County?”, the AI pulls from trusted, well-structured sources. If your website’s content isn’t authoritative, clearly organized, and locally specific, the AI skips you entirely — even if you rank well in classic search results.

This is a fundamentally different challenge, and it requires a specialist skill set. A general SEO vendor isn’t enough. You need practitioners who understand how large language models evaluate credibility, how to write content that AI systems parse as citable, and how to build the local entity signals that tie your firm to Dayton specifically.

The Specific Ways GEO Experts Help Law Firms Get Found

Structured, Citable Content

AI systems favor content that answers questions directly, uses clear structure, and demonstrates domain expertise. GEO experts audit your existing pages and rewrite or supplement them so that FAQ-style answers, practice area explanations, and process descriptions are formatted in ways that large language models can confidently extract and cite. For a Dayton personal injury firm, that might mean a detailed, well-sourced page on Ohio’s statute of limitations for injury claims — written to be quoted, not just read.

Local Entity Signals

Search engines and AI platforms build a mental map of every business. GEO experts strengthen the signals that tie your firm to Dayton — your Google Business Profile, local citations, schema markup that names your service area, and mentions in regionally authoritative publications. A firm that appears consistently across the Dayton Bar Association’s resources, the Dayton Daily News, and local legal directories carries far more weight with an AI engine than a firm with a pretty website and nothing else.

Authority Building Through E-E-A-T

Google’s own guidelines for creating helpful, people-first content emphasize Experience, Expertise, Authoritativeness, and Trustworthiness. AI systems have absorbed these same standards. GEO experts build content strategies that demonstrate your attorneys’ real credentials, case experience, and community involvement — the kind of authentic authority signals that AI tools use to decide whose answer to surface.

What to Look for When Hiring GEO Experts for Your Law Firm

Not every agency that mentions “AI SEO” has genuine GEO expertise. When evaluating partners, ask specifically about their process for structuring citable content, how they build local entity authority, and what they track beyond keyword rankings. A real GEO expert can explain how AI models evaluate trustworthiness and walk you through concrete changes they’d make to your site.

Look for a team that understands the legal vertical specifically. Law firm marketing has unique compliance considerations — bar association advertising rules in Ohio govern how attorneys can describe their services and outcomes. A GEO agency that works with law firms knows those guardrails and builds content that’s both AI-optimized and ethically compliant.

Frequently Asked Questions About GEO for Dayton Law Firms

What does a GEO expert actually do for a law firm?

A GEO expert restructures and supplements your firm’s content so that AI-powered search tools — like ChatGPT, Google AI Overviews, and Perplexity — cite your firm when users ask legal questions. This includes writing citable content, building local authority signals, and optimizing schema markup so AI engines understand who you are, where you practice, and what you specialize in.

Is GEO different from traditional SEO?

Yes. Traditional SEO focuses on ranking in classic search engine results pages. GEO focuses on getting your content cited or featured by AI-generated answers. Both matter, but GEO requires a different skill set, different content formats, and a different understanding of how large language models evaluate credibility.

Why do Dayton law firms specifically need GEO optimization?

Dayton’s legal market is competitive and hyperlocal, with clients searching for attorneys in specific neighborhoods, suburbs like Kettering and Centerville, and across Montgomery County. As AI tools become the first stop for people searching for legal help, firms without GEO optimization are being skipped — even if their traditional rankings look strong.

How long does it take to see results from GEO work?

GEO is not an overnight fix, but many firms begin appearing in AI-generated responses within a few months of implementing structured content and authority-building strategies. The timeline depends on how authoritative your site currently is, how competitive your practice areas are, and the consistency of your local entity signals.

Can GEO work alongside my existing SEO strategy?

Absolutely. GEO and traditional SEO complement each other well. Strong foundational SEO — fast site, clean architecture, solid backlinks — supports GEO by making your content easier for both search engines and AI systems to trust and index. The best approach integrates both.

Does Ohio bar advertising rules affect GEO content?

Yes. Ohio’s Rules of Professional Conduct regulate how attorneys describe their services, results, and expertise in advertising. A GEO expert who works with law firms understands these rules and writes content that is both AI-optimized and compliant, so you don’t gain visibility at the cost of a bar complaint.
